He sprinkled lime green throughout, so that three-quarter length, wide-legged, pleat-fronted trousers came over lizard skin pumps that added a flash of colour or softly tailored jackets had green peeping from the button holes, their sassy office wear, identikit waved hair and low-heeled lace-up boots giving them not a care in the world.
The grey was whipped into Armani’s current favourite waffled silk jackets, featured green go faster stripes down the sides of silky track pants, was shredded into split sleeves on a square cut jacket, or sparkled like spun sugar on a stiff shawl.
Sheepskin bags smothered in pompoms or in wide mesh knit added a light hearted attitude to what was otherwise a languid, relaxed collection and the grey looked most elegant transformed into every combination of glittering, attention-seeking evening wear.
